She’Koyokh has been hailed as “one of the finest and most entertaining British-based exponents of global music” (The Guardian). The London-based band has dedicated over two decades to embracing the diverse folk music traditions of Jewish Eastern Europe, Turkey, and the Balkans.
The ensemble’s live performances are a captivating mix of instruments including clarinet, violin, jazzy guitar licks, accordion, bass, and dance invoking percussion, plus the sweet and passionate voice of Istanbul-born Çigdem Aslan.
